4.2 THE MTD 112 LLCa CONTROLLER
a) Functions
The MTD 112 LLCa controller performs the following functions:
* Band rejection : The frequencies that cannot be reproduced by the system are
rejected, i.e. below 50 Hz (in "Front" configuration) and above 20 kHz.
* Filtering : Filtering functions are provided at 110 Hz for X.OVER configuration and on
the "sub" channel.
* Equalization : The unit equalizes the frequency responses of the drivers/enclosure
assembly. The EQ functions are of the parametric type, especially designed for minimum
phase alteration. The EQ does vary according to the selected configuration in the L.F.
range.
* Limitation : The unit takes the power amplifier in a global feedback loop, using the output
of the amplifier to control VCAs limiting the output of the unit . The control signal is derived
from the "sense return" path.
2 limitations functions are provided: - cone excursion limitation for the L.F. driver
- thermal limitation for the L.F. and the H.F. drivers
These functions are carefully adjusted for minimum audible effect and thorough driver
protection.
* Mono summation: The inputs of two MTD 112 LLCa controllers are summed to derive a
mono signal capable of driving a central source. This mono signal can be the simple sum of
the inputs, for driving a central broad-band source, or can be filtered for driving a central
subwoofer.
